My Product Testing Process

1. Ingredient Analysis – I review the full ingredient list for proven actives and potential irritants.

2. Real-World Testing – I use the product for a minimum of 30 days.

3. Client Testing – Products are tested on at least 3 clients with different skin types.

4. Value Assessment – A $100 product needs to perform dramatically better than a $20 alternative.

Best Skincare Products by Concern

For Acne-Prone Skin

  • Best Cleanser: CeraVe Foaming Facial Cleanser – Under $15
  • Best Treatment: Paula’s Choice 2% BHA Liquid Exfoliant
  • Best Moisturizer: Neutrogena Hydro Boost Gel-Cream

For Dry Skin

  • Best Cleanser: CeraVe Hydrating Facial Cleanser
  • Best Serum: The Ordinary Hyaluronic Acid 2% + B5
  • Best Moisturizer: CeraVe Moisturizing Cream

For Anti-Aging

  • Best Retinol: The Ordinary Retinol 0.5% in Squalane
  • Best Vitamin C: Timeless Vitamin C + E Ferulic Acid
  • Best Moisturizer: Olay Regenerist Micro-Sculpting Cream

For Sensitive Skin

  • Best Cleanser: Vanicream Gentle Facial Cleanser
  • Best Moisturizer: La Roche-Posay Toleriane Double Repair
  • Best Sunscreen: EltaMD UV Clear SPF 46
